A thermostat is a temperature sensitive device used in a vehicle's cooling system to control the flow of coolant between the engine block and radiator. A thermostat is important for several reasons. 1. It helps allow the engine to operate at optimal fuel efficiency. 2. It allows the engine to reach optimum operating temperature quickly. When the engine is cold, the thermostat stays closed, allowing the engine to reach operating temperature quickly. Once the engine approaches a predetermined operating temperature (typically 180-220 degrees F.), the thermostat begins to open and allows coolant flow from the radiator to the engine.

Mainly it serves as an emission control device by allowing internal engine temperature to remain within normal operating ranges.

Application calls for 195 degree automotive thermostat can you use 180 degree thermostat?

Using a 180-degree thermostat in an application that calls for a 195-degree thermostat may lead to the engine running cooler than optimal. This could result in reduced fuel efficiency, increased emissions, and potential issues with engine performance, especially in colder conditions. It's best to use the specified thermostat to ensure the engine operates within the designed temperature range for optimal performance and longevity.

How long does it take to change a thermostat in a 2002 Nissan Sentra?

Changing a thermostat in a 2002 Nissan Sentra typically takes about 1 to 2 hours, depending on your mechanical experience and the tools available. The process involves draining the coolant, removing the thermostat housing, and replacing the old thermostat with a new one before reassembling. It's important to ensure the system is properly refilled with coolant and any air is bled from the system afterward. If you're unfamiliar with automotive repairs, it may take longer.
